
Boys & Girls Club of New Rochelle announced several innovative youth-development partnerships and honored community champions during its 2025 “Be Great” Annual Gala at the famed Wykagyl Country Club in New Rochelle.
The high-energy sold-out Gala on May 27, celebrating the Boys & Girls Club’s 96th year, was attended by community supporters, donors, elected officials from the City of New Rochelle and the region, and representatives of corporations as well as the City School District of New Rochelle. The Gala celebrated the Club’s record-setting 10,000 youths served during 2024 as well as achievement-driven programming encompassing academics, mental wellness, fitness, leadership, and civics. The Club has long been one of Westchester County’s largest nonprofits and a leader in youth development. The Gala was preceded by a capacity crowd of golfers playing on Wykagyl’s iconic course. The event also included live and silent auctions, as well as “Giving Tree” opportunities to support scholarships, Summer Camp participation and snacks for members.
